Grinch Green Popcorn Delight Recipe

A festive and fun Grinch Popcorn snack featuring green candy-coated popcorn mixed with mini marshmallows, green sprinkles, and a hint of salt. Perfect for holiday parties or a playful treat anytime.

Ingredients

Popcorn Base

  • 12 cups popped popcorn (about ½ cup unpopped kernels)

Candy Coating and Toppings

  • 1 cup green candy melts
  • 1 cup mini marshmallows
  • ½ cup green sprinkles
  • ¼ teaspoon salt

Instructions

  1. Pop the Popcorn: Begin by popping the popcorn kernels using an air popper or stovetop method until you have about 12 cups of popped popcorn. Place the popped popcorn in a large mixing bowl.
  2. Prepare the Baking Sheet: Line a baking sheet with parchment paper to prevent the popcorn from sticking later.
  3. Melt the Candy Coating: In a microwave-safe bowl, melt the green candy melts in 30-second increments, stirring between each until completely smooth and melted.
  4. Coat the Popcorn: Pour the melted green candy over the popcorn in the mixing bowl and gently toss with a spatula or spoon to coat the popcorn evenly.
  5. Add Toppings: Sprinkle mini marshmallows, green sprinkles, and salt over the coated popcorn, then toss again to evenly distribute all toppings.
  6. Set the Popcorn: Spread the popcorn mixture onto the prepared baking sheet in an even layer. Allow it to cool for a few minutes so the candy melts can harden and set.
  7. Serve or Store: Once cooled, break the popcorn into pieces and serve immediately or store in an airtight container for up to one week at room temperature.

Notes

  • Customize by adding crushed pretzels or nuts for extra flavor and texture.
  • For a more festive look, add red candy or chocolate pieces to mimic a classic Grinch theme.
  • Ensure candy melts are fully melted before coating to avoid clumps.
  • Use parchment paper on the baking sheet to make cleanup easier.
  • Store the popcorn in an airtight container to keep it fresh.
